What You’ll Do

  • Liaise with stakeholders to acquire placement opportunities.
  • Provide information to support the coordination of international cross-border labour migration functions.
  • Assist in the registration and certification processes for Private Employment Agencies.
  • Coordinate large provincial opportunities from key stakeholders to enhance employment access.

What You’ll Need

  • A Grade 12/Matriculation Senior Certificate.
  • Knowledge of relevant ILO Conventions and Human Resource Management practices.
  • Familiarity with Batho Pele Principles.
  • Strong planning and organising skills.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ication abilities.
  • Analytical skills and computer literacy.
  • Proficiency in presentation and interpersonal skills.
  • Capable of report writing and demonstrating innovative thinking.
